Brazil's GOL Linhas holders waive debenture covenant non-compliance

By Marisa Wong

Madison, Wis., March 19 - GOL Linhas Aereas Inteligentes SA obtained a waiver from holders of its fourth and fifth issue debentures in relation to its non-compliance with certain financial covenants under the debentures, according to a 6-K filed Monday with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

The waiver was approved at a meeting of debenture holders on Feb. 15.

Last month GOL Linhas said it anticipated that as of Dec. 31 it was not in compliance with certain restrictive contractual clauses. The company requested waivers for this non-compliance and reclassified its debentures, totaling R$1.09 billion, to short-term debt from long-term debt in its 2011 annual financial statements.

According to the filing, the company is now compliant with its obligations under the terms of the debentures, and the debenture issues will once again be classified as long-term debt.

The discount air carrier is based in Sao Paulo.
